> Ok, with the patches we got NSS covered, but we still need to do something for 
> other users.
> 
> A first look at stuff we ship, this seems to be their current status:
> * NSS:
> ice* packages should be okay after the latest NSS update.
> 
> * OpenSSL
> Nothing special here
> 
> * GnuTLS
> Nothing special here
> 
> * chromium:
> Even after the NSS update, it seems to be happy to use the Explicitly 
> Distrusted certs.

Note that this suggests others NSS using applications may be affected
too, if they don't do the appropriate thing for untrusted certs.
I know at least pidgin and evolution use NSS.
